Ro
Root Candle Studio
5450 W Lovers Ln #131, Dallas, TX 75209, United States
Information
  • Address:5450 W Lovers Ln #131, Dallas, TX 75209, United States
  • Phone:+1 214-350-9535
Categories
  • Candle store
Planning
  • Quick visit:Yes
Similar organizations